PeopleSoft users to get more function options
Over the next several months, PeopleSoft users can expect new functions to become available through integration with third-party software made possible by new APIs from the enterprise resource planning (ERP) vendor.
The Extensible Markup Language (XML)-based Open Integration Framework strategy PeopleSoft announced in April is now bearing fruit, promising easy socketlike integrations to third-party functions that the PeopleSoft ERP suite currently lacks, such as logistics, sales, and customer service.
